Output 9151e10bcf374d6d7564bb7a45561983c71ae2cba1f8f406c0c33c5de0d09d50:3

value
1572
script pubkey
OP_0 OP_PUSHBYTES_20 8c3b7d51af128b6298441925de4caafc82454c3b
address
bc1q3sah65d0z29k9xzyryjaun92ljpy2npm0qhevz
transaction
9151e10bcf374d6d7564bb7a45561983c71ae2cba1f8f406c0c33c5de0d09d50
confirmations
64730
spent
true